You’re Invited to Explore the Outdoors!

Come join the fun with the Community Idea Stations, Science Matters and Chesterfield County Parks and Recreation. From nature walks to outdoor investigations, families, friends, and neighbors are invited to participate in hands-on experiences that encourage kids to learn about science. The day will feature 40+ local organizations who specialize in outdoor activities for families. This community event is free and open to the public.
Explore the Outdoors parking will be held at Huguenot Park. Event activities will take place in the park and on the grounds of the Community Idea Stations adjacent to the park. The station studios will be open for tours and kids will have a chance to meet Curious George plus see themselves on TV.
When: Sunday, April 28, 2013 at 1:00-5:00 p.m. • Rain 0r Shine
Where: Huguenot Park • 10901 Robious Road • North Chesterfield, VA 23235
Questions: Call the Community Idea Stations at (804) 320.1301
